"Properties of polydimethylsiloxane"
Polydimethylsiloxane has many unique properties. Its texture is supple, smooth to the touch, like a fat paste, it extends unhindered on the skin, like a light cloud blowing the body, and it feels good to the touch.
Its chemical properties are stable, and it does not react significantly with common acids and alkalis. It is like a hermit, and it is unique in the turbulent chemical world. It can operate in a variety of environments without losing its properties. Its heat-resistant and cold-resistant ability is also outstanding. It does not flow or melt under high temperatures, and it is not brittle or cracked in severe cold. It is like a pine and cypress, which is still upright after cold and heat.
Its dielectric properties are excellent, like an invisible barrier, which is orderly regulated between the conduction of electricity, so that the current follows the rules and ensures the stable operation of electrical equipment. And it has good demoulding, where the utensils are formed, according to its help, they can come out smoothly, like a butterfly breaking a cocoon, natural and smooth, without damage to the shape of the utensils.
As for the waterproof property, it is also quite impressive. When it comes to water, it is rejected. The surface of the water droplets rolls like pearls and jade, not soaked in water, like a lotus leaf, forming a dry world on its own.
From this perspective, polydimethylsiloxane is very useful in various fields such as industry and daily use due to its unique properties. It is actually a good material with specific physical properties.
